From The Edge: Upgrading to R:BASE 7.6/Turbo V-8 for Windows

Supported Versions:

. R:BASE 7.6 for Windows (Build: 7.6.3.30404 or higher)
. R:BASE C/S:I 7.6 for Windows (Build: 7.6.3.30404 or higher)
. R:BASE Turbo V-8 for Windows (Build: 8.0.17.30404 or higher)

The Conversion Guide, a technical document, is now available
to explain the step-by-step process and technique to upgrade
a legacy database to R:BASE 7.6 and Turbo V-8 for Windows.
